Expert Analysis
Uses sodium thioglycolate at 10-20% concentration as the primary iron-chelating agent, maintaining a neutral pH of 7.5 to balance effectiveness with surface safety. The formulation incorporates both anionic and nonionic surfactants to provide cleaning action beyond iron removal, while an improved rheology modifier enhances surface cling for extended dwell time.

Potential Concerns
- ⚠Carries 'Danger' signal word indicating significant hazard classification despite neutral pH
- ⚠Still retains characteristic thioglycolate odor despite lower-odor claims
- ⚠High concentration may require careful application timing to prevent surface staining
